Skip to content

Palette Entry Visibility

gameztaker edited this page Nov 30, 2016 · 15 revisions

The following tables display which Palette Entry is influenced (i.e. made visible) by which Feature Expression. For each status of the editor (Step-In / Step-Out) exists one table, as there are notable differences. The third table simply lists all Features, which have no impact on the Palette Entry visibility.
Please note that we have the options Always and Never, which symbolize that the respective Palette Entry is not related to the selected Configuration (i.e. the selected Features). Furthermore, a Palette Entry might only be dependent on a single Feature, in which case the relevant Feature Expression is just a single literal.

Step-Out Table (normal view/top-level view)

Each row starts with the name of a Palette Entry. The comlumns symbolize that the named Palette Entry is either Always or Never visible, or visible if the expression stated in the column Feature Expression is true.
To be read as: Palette Entry X is ((always|never) visible|visible if the provided Feature Expression can be evaluated to true).

Palette Entry (Step-OUT) Always Never Feature Expression
Role Type X
Role Group X
Role Implication X
Relationship Implication X
Relationship Exclusion X
Role Equivalence X
Role Prohibition X
Relationship X
Reflexive X
Irreflexive X
Total X
Cyclic X
Acyclic X
Compartment Compartment_Types
Natural Type X
Data Type Data_Types
Group X
Fulfillment X
Operation X
Attribute X
Inheritance X
Role_Model !Compartment_Types

Step-In Table

Each row starts with the name of a Palette Entry. The comlumns symbolize that the named Palette Entry is either Always or Never visible, or visible if the expression stated in the column Feature Expression is true.
To be read as: Palette Entry X is ((always|never) visible|visible if the provided Feature Expression can be evaluated to true).

Palette Entry (Step-IN) Always Never Feature Expression
Role Type X
Role Group Group_Constraints
Role Implication Role_Implication
Relationship Implication Inter_Relationship_Constraints
Relationship Exclusion Inter_Relationship_Constraints
Role Equivalence Role_Equivalence
Role Prohibition Role_Prohibition
Relationship Relationships
Reflexive Intra_Relationship_Constraints
Irreflexive Intra_Relationship_Constraints
Total Intra_Relationship_Constraints
Cyclic Intra_Relationship_Constraints
Acyclic Intra_Relationship_Constraints
Compartment (X) Contains_Compartments (Not Available Yet)
Natural Type X
Data Type X
Group X
Fulfillment X
Operation (Role_Behavior OR Compartment_Behavior)
Attribute (Role_Properties OR Compartment_Properties)
Inheritance (Role_Inheritance OR (Compartment_InheritanceAND Contains_Compartments))
Role_Model !Compartment_Types

Features Without Impact on Palette Entry Visibility

Feature Name Comment
Role_Types
Role_Structure
Playable
Players
Naturals
Compartments
Dependent
On_Compartments
On_Relationships
On_Constraints
Occurrence_Constraints
Relationship_Constraints
Relationship_Cardinality
Parthood_Constraints
Compartment_Structure
Participants
(Contains_Compartments) Feature not yet selectable and therefore without impact, but in the above tables already used (and crossed out)
Playable_By_Defining_Compartment
Data_Type_Inheritance

Clone this wiki locally